linux-samus icon indicating copy to clipboard operation
linux-samus copied to clipboard

Ubuntu Kernel Installation fails

Open Honest-Objections opened this issue 8 years ago • 4 comments

sudo dpkg -i *.deb results in Error! Bad return status for module build on kernel: 4.9.6-ph+ (x86_64)

/var/lib/dkms/ndiswrapper/1.59/build/wrapndis.c: In function ‘tx_worker’: /var/lib/dkms/ndiswrapper/1.59/build/wrapndis.c:707:16: error: ‘struct net_device’ has no member named ‘trans_start’ wnd->net_dev->trans_start = jiffies; ^ scripts/Makefile.build:293: recipe for target '/var/lib/dkms/ndiswrapper/1.59/build/wrapndis.o' failed make[1]: *** [/var/lib/dkms/ndiswrapper/1.59/build/wrapndis.o] Error 1 Makefile:1490: recipe for target 'module/var/lib/dkms/ndiswrapper/1.59/build' failed make: *** [module/var/lib/dkms/ndiswrapper/1.59/build] Error 2 make: Leaving directory '/usr/src/linux-headers-4.9.6-ph+'

Honest-Objections avatar Jan 29 '17 19:01 Honest-Objections

@Honest-Objections which version of ubuntu? Also, a more complete log would help.

nskaggs avatar Feb 08 '17 19:02 nskaggs

same problem. Linux Mint 18.1 G50 kernel # uname -a Linux G50 4.8.2-040802-generic #201610161339 SMP Sun Oct 16 17:41:46 UTC 2016 x86_64 x86_64 x86_64 GNU/Linux

G50 kernel # sudo dpkg -i linux-headers-4.9.0*.deb linux-image-4.9.0*.deb(Reading database ... 597307 files and directories currently installed.) Preparing to unpack linux-headers-4.9.0-040900_4.9.0-040900.201612111631_all.deb ... Unpacking linux-headers-4.9.0-040900 (4.9.0-040900.201612111631) over (4.9.0-040900.201612111631) ... Preparing to unpack linux-headers-4.9.0-040900-generic_4.9.0-040900.201612111631_amd64.deb ... Unpacking linux-headers-4.9.0-040900-generic (4.9.0-040900.201612111631) over (4.9.0-040900.201612111631) ... Preparing to unpack linux-image-4.9.0-040900-generic_4.9.0-040900.201612111631_amd64.deb ... Done. Unpacking linux-image-4.9.0-040900-generic (4.9.0-040900.201612111631) ... dpkg-deb (subprocess): cannot copy archive member from 'linux-image-4.9.0-040900-generic_4.9.0-040900.201612111631_amd64.deb' to decompressor pipe: unexpected end of file or stream dpkg-deb (subprocess): decompressing archive member: internal bzip2 read error: 'UNEXPECTED_EOF' dpkg-deb: error: subprocess returned error exit status 2 dpkg: error processing archive linux-image-4.9.0-040900-generic_4.9.0-040900.201612111631_amd64.deb (--install): cannot copy extracted data for './boot/vmlinuz-4.9.0-040900-generic' to '/boot/vmlinuz-4.9.0-040900-generic.dpkg-new': unexpected end of file or stream Examining /etc/kernel/postrm.d . run-parts: executing /etc/kernel/postrm.d/initramfs-tools 4.9.0-040900-generic /boot/vmlinuz-4.9.0-040900-generic run-parts: executing /etc/kernel/postrm.d/zz-update-grub 4.9.0-040900-generic /boot/vmlinuz-4.9.0-040900-generic Setting up linux-headers-4.9.0-040900 (4.9.0-040900.201612111631) ... Setting up linux-headers-4.9.0-040900-generic (4.9.0-040900.201612111631) ... Examining /etc/kernel/header_postinst.d. run-parts: executing /etc/kernel/header_postinst.d/dkms 4.9.0-040900-generic /boot/vmlinuz-4.9.0-040900-generic Error! Bad return status for module build on kernel: 4.9.0-040900-generic (x86_64) Consult /var/lib/dkms/ndiswrapper/1.59/build/make.log for more information. Errors were encountered while processing: linux-image-4.9.0-040900-generic_4.9.0-040900.201612111631_amd64.deb

------------- make.log file -----------------------> DKMS make.log for ndiswrapper-1.59 for kernel 4.9.0-040900-generic (x86_64) Tue Feb 21 17:06:36 BRT 2017 make: Entering directory '/usr/src/linux-headers-4.9.0-040900-generic' LD /var/lib/dkms/ndiswrapper/1.59/build/built-in.o MKEXPORT /var/lib/dkms/ndiswrapper/1.59/build/crt_exports.h MKEXPORT /var/lib/dkms/ndiswrapper/1.59/build/hal_exports.h MKEXPORT /var/lib/dkms/ndiswrapper/1.59/build/ndis_exports.h MKEXPORT /var/lib/dkms/ndiswrapper/1.59/build/ntoskernel_exports.h MKEXPORT /var/lib/dkms/ndiswrapper/1.59/build/ntoskernel_io_exports.h MKEXPORT /var/lib/dkms/ndiswrapper/1.59/build/rtl_exports.h MKEXPORT /var/lib/dkms/ndiswrapper/1.59/build/usb_exports.h MKSTUBS /var/lib/dkms/ndiswrapper/1.59/build/win2lin_stubs.h CC [M] /var/lib/dkms/ndiswrapper/1.59/build/crt.o CC [M] /var/lib/dkms/ndiswrapper/1.59/build/hal.o CC [M] /var/lib/dkms/ndiswrapper/1.59/build/iw_ndis.o CC [M] /var/lib/dkms/ndiswrapper/1.59/build/loader.o CC [M] /var/lib/dkms/ndiswrapper/1.59/build/ndis.o CC [M] /var/lib/dkms/ndiswrapper/1.59/build/ntoskernel.o CC [M] /var/lib/dkms/ndiswrapper/1.59/build/ntoskernel_io.o CC [M] /var/lib/dkms/ndiswrapper/1.59/build/pe_linker.o CC [M] /var/lib/dkms/ndiswrapper/1.59/build/pnp.o CC [M] /var/lib/dkms/ndiswrapper/1.59/build/proc.o CC [M] /var/lib/dkms/ndiswrapper/1.59/build/rtl.o CC [M] /var/lib/dkms/ndiswrapper/1.59/build/wrapmem.o CC [M] /var/lib/dkms/ndiswrapper/1.59/build/wrapndis.o /var/lib/dkms/ndiswrapper/1.59/build/wrapndis.c: In function ‘tx_worker’: /var/lib/dkms/ndiswrapper/1.59/build/wrapndis.c:707:16: error: ‘struct net_device’ has no member named ‘trans_start’ wnd->net_dev->trans_start = jiffies; ^ scripts/Makefile.build:293: recipe for target '/var/lib/dkms/ndiswrapper/1.59/build/wrapndis.o' failed make[1]: *** [/var/lib/dkms/ndiswrapper/1.59/build/wrapndis.o] Error 1 Makefile:1496: recipe for target 'module/var/lib/dkms/ndiswrapper/1.59/build' failed make: *** [module/var/lib/dkms/ndiswrapper/1.59/build] Error 2 make: Leaving directory '/usr/src/linux-headers-4.9.0-040900-generic'

fluidvoice avatar Feb 21 '17 20:02 fluidvoice

My issue was also on Linux Mint 18.1, worth noting the kernel still installed

Honest-Objections avatar Feb 21 '17 20:02 Honest-Objections

For me it did not. Never got the the point of updating Grub. Kernel 4.10 also had errors but did get to seemed to finish. Have not rebooted yet...

brad@G50 ~/working/kernel/kern410 $ sudo dpkg -i *.deb Selecting previously unselected package linux-headers-4.10.0-041000. (Reading database ... 597307 files and directories currently installed.) Preparing to unpack linux-headers-4.10.0-041000_4.10.0-041000.201702191831_all.deb ... Unpacking linux-headers-4.10.0-041000 (4.10.0-041000.201702191831) ... Selecting previously unselected package linux-headers-4.10.0-041000-generic. Preparing to unpack linux-headers-4.10.0-041000-generic_4.10.0-041000.201702191831_amd64.deb ... Unpacking linux-headers-4.10.0-041000-generic (4.10.0-041000.201702191831) ... Selecting previously unselected package linux-image-4.10.0-041000-generic. Preparing to unpack linux-image-4.10.0-041000-generic_4.10.0-041000.201702191831_amd64.deb ... Done. Unpacking linux-image-4.10.0-041000-generic (4.10.0-041000.201702191831) ... Setting up linux-headers-4.10.0-041000 (4.10.0-041000.201702191831) ... Setting up linux-headers-4.10.0-041000-generic (4.10.0-041000.201702191831) ... Examining /etc/kernel/header_postinst.d. run-parts: executing /etc/kernel/header_postinst.d/dkms 4.10.0-041000-generic /boot/vmlinuz-4.10.0-041000-generic Error! Bad return status for module build on kernel: 4.10.0-041000-generic (x86_64) Consult /var/lib/dkms/ndiswrapper/1.59/build/make.log for more information. Error! Bad return status for module build on kernel: 4.10.0-041000-generic (x86_64) Consult /var/lib/dkms/virtualbox-guest/5.0.32/build/make.log for more information. Setting up linux-image-4.10.0-041000-generic (4.10.0-041000.201702191831) ... Running depmod. update-initramfs: deferring update (hook will be called later) Examining /etc/kernel/postinst.d. run-parts: executing /etc/kernel/postinst.d/apt-auto-removal 4.10.0-041000-generic /boot/vmlinuz-4.10.0-041000-generic run-parts: executing /etc/kernel/postinst.d/dkms 4.10.0-041000-generic /boot/vmlinuz-4.10.0-041000-generic Error! Bad return status for module build on kernel: 4.10.0-041000-generic (x86_64) Consult /var/lib/dkms/ndiswrapper/1.59/build/make.log for more information. Error! Bad return status for module build on kernel: 4.10.0-041000-generic (x86_64) Consult /var/lib/dkms/virtualbox-guest/5.0.32/build/make.log for more information. run-parts: executing /etc/kernel/postinst.d/initramfs-tools 4.10.0-041000-generic /boot/vmlinuz-4.10.0-041000-generic update-initramfs: Generating /boot/initrd.img-4.10.0-041000-generic W: Possible missing firmware /lib/firmware/radeon/si58_mc.bin for module radeon W: Possible missing firmware /lib/firmware/radeon/banks_k_2_smc.bin for module radeon W: Possible missing firmware /lib/firmware/radeon/si58_mc.bin for module amdgpu W: Possible missing firmware /lib/firmware/radeon/banks_k_2_smc.bin for module amdgpu W: Possible missing firmware /lib/firmware/amdgpu/polaris12_smc.bin for module amdgpu W: Possible missing firmware /lib/firmware/amdgpu/tonga_k_smc.bin for module amdgpu W: Possible missing firmware /lib/firmware/amdgpu/topaz_k_smc.bin for module amdgpu W: Possible missing firmware /lib/firmware/amdgpu/polaris12_mc.bin for module amdgpu W: Possible missing firmware /lib/firmware/amdgpu/polaris12_rlc.bin for module amdgpu W: Possible missing firmware /lib/firmware/amdgpu/polaris12_mec2.bin for module amdgpu W: Possible missing firmware /lib/firmware/amdgpu/polaris12_mec.bin for module amdgpu W: Possible missing firmware /lib/firmware/amdgpu/polaris12_me.bin for module amdgpu W: Possible missing firmware /lib/firmware/amdgpu/polaris12_pfp.bin for module amdgpu W: Possible missing firmware /lib/firmware/amdgpu/polaris12_ce.bin for module amdgpu W: Possible missing firmware /lib/firmware/amdgpu/polaris12_sdma1.bin for module amdgpu W: Possible missing firmware /lib/firmware/amdgpu/polaris12_sdma.bin for module amdgpu W: Possible missing firmware /lib/firmware/amdgpu/polaris12_uvd.bin for module amdgpu W: Possible missing firmware /lib/firmware/amdgpu/polaris12_vce.bin for module amdgpu run-parts: executing /etc/kernel/postinst.d/pm-utils 4.10.0-041000-generic /boot/vmlinuz-4.10.0-041000-generic run-parts: executing /etc/kernel/postinst.d/unattended-upgrades 4.10.0-041000-generic /boot/vmlinuz-4.10.0-041000-generic run-parts: executing /etc/kernel/postinst.d/zz-update-grub 4.10.0-041000-generic /boot/vmlinuz-4.10.0-041000-generic Generating grub configuration file ... ... Adding boot menu entry for EFI firmware configuration done

fluidvoice avatar Feb 21 '17 21:02 fluidvoice